Insider tips for enjoying night shows and performances in Zimbabwe

Make sure to immerse yourself in the local culture by trying traditional food and beverages at the venues. Additionally, consider participating in any interactive performances to get a truly memorable experience. For a unique evening, venture off the beaten path and explore the smaller, local venues for intimate shows and performances.

One specific recommendation is to attend the HIFA (Harare International Festival of the Arts) for a true celebration of Zimbabwean arts and culture.
